About the Pomeranian

The Pomeranian is a small dog breed that originated in the Pomerania region, which is now part of Poland and Germany. It is known for its distinctive fluffy coat, fox-like face, and lively personality. Pomeranians are classified as toy dogs and are one of the smallest members of the Spitz family. They have a compact and sturdy build, with a plumed tail that arches over their back.

Pomeranians are highly intelligent and energetic dogs despite their small size. They are often described as confident, curious, and extroverted. They form strong bonds with their owners and can be quite affectionate and loyal. Despite their small stature, Pomeranians have a bold and assertive nature, often displaying a fearless attitude that belies their size.

One of the most recognizable features of the Pomeranian is its luxurious double coat, which consists of a dense undercoat and a profuse outer coat that stands off the body. Their coat comes in a wide variety of colors and patterns, including orange, black, cream, blue, sable, and more. However, maintaining their coat requires regular grooming to prevent matting and keep it in good condition.

Pomeranians thrive on attention and enjoy being the center of attention. They can be good family pets but may not be suitable for households with very young children due to their delicate size. Early socialization and consistent training are important to ensure they grow up to be well-behaved and well-rounded companions.

Overall, the Pomeranian is a charming and lively companion that offers a big personality in a small package. With proper care, training, and socialization, they can make delightful and loyal pets for individuals and families alike.

Did You Know?

Royalty's Favorite Companion: Pomeranians have a rich history and were favored by European royalty, including Queen Victoria of England. Queen Victoria played a significant role in popularizing the breed during the 19th century. She owned numerous Pomeranians and actively bred them to reduce their size and enhance their coat's fluffiness. Her passion for the breed led to the miniaturization of Pomeranians, making them even more appealing as companion dogs.

The Pomeranian is one of the smallest dog breeds, but its ancestors were much larger. The breed originated from larger sled-pulling Spitz-type dogs in the Arctic regions. Through selective breeding over generations, the Pomeranian gradually reduced in size, resulting in the tiny, adorable breed we know today. It's fascinating to see how the breed's appearance has transformed over time.

Despite their small size, Pomeranians are known for their larger-than-life personalities. They are confident, self-assured, and often have no awareness of their diminutive stature. Pomeranians tend to exhibit a bold and fearless nature, making them excellent watchdogs who will readily alert their owners to any perceived threats. Their lively and spirited demeanor adds to their charm and makes them stand out among other toy breeds.
